Fallen RIP Nathan Woods #54

Well i'm sure you all have heard by now but after i posted it in chat it was suggested i post in this forum. Nathan Woods was an insanly talented rider with 2 WORCs Championships and more individual race wins than any rider in the history or WORCs. He passed after being airlifted from Round 1 practice in Taft, CA earlier today where he was kicked off of his bike on a table top and landed head first. I have watched him race at both WORCs races i've attended and he was definatly one of the best! He was from Paso Robles, CA and is survived by his wife, Amanda, and two sons, Nate and Braxton.
